MARS HILL, N.C. – In a non-conference road game, the Malone men's lacrosse team was defeated by Mars Hill University on Saturday afternoon. The final score was 20-8. The Pioneers are now 1-2 on the 2025 season while the Lions advance to 3-2.
Mars Hill took a 4-1 advantage in the first quarter with the lone Malone goal scored by
Ramsey Burnard.
Talon Heath would find Burnard again just before the end of the period, but through 15 minutes, it was 5-2 in favor of the Lions.
The Mars Hill lead grew to 11-4 at halftime. Heath netted the two goals in that frame for the Pioneers.
Darek Smith found Heath on the second goal with just 15 seconds remaining in the second quarter.
Malone was outscored 3-1 in the third quarter and 6-3 in the fourth to get to the 20-8 final score.
Zac Smargiasso was the only newcomer to the scoring column in the second half. The duo of Heath (4) and Burnard (3) accounted for seven of the team's eight goals and Smith four of five assists.
22 of the team's 31 shots were on goal for the Pioneers to credit quality defense played by the Lions. In goal, Malone had ten saves, four by
Trent Urquhart (0-1) and six by
Alex Lavalle.
